Output 781d3e56000f89af77d2b4fe64b6b29bcbd85c09f3bda89c662611491e4242e6:0

value
50160000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42b23eac6e96f13635cab1eb90dbc93df653de84 OP_EQUALVERIFY OP_CHECKSIG
address
175f8L28XepnoowKMkE3Bz2rgahh6S1zqa
transaction
781d3e56000f89af77d2b4fe64b6b29bcbd85c09f3bda89c662611491e4242e6
spent
true